AirWatch 8 release promises more to enterprises

Enterprise mobility management (EMM) vendor AirWatch by VMware today announced the release of AirWatch 8.

AirWatch 8 will extend the ability to pre-register Intel devices running Android to auto-enroll once a device is powered on with a persistent agent. AirWatch 8 will provide added customization, supports tokens for organization groups and bring management improvements for Apple iOS.

This apart, the latest EMM solution ensures alternative biometric and multi-factor authentication, including Apple Touch ID integration in the AirWatch SDK and integration with EyeVerify for eye scan password replacement.

AirWatch has redesigned the web enrollment interface to provide better intuitive experience for the user throughout the enrollment process and to reduce support calls for IT.

The integration with AppleCare will support IT to access the information such as warranty status and purchase date.

AirWatch 8 will simplify enterprise mobility with unified endpoint management capabilities that enable IT to manage all end user devices from a single pane of glass.

“Enterprise mobility management is transforming from single point solutions into comprehensive platforms that focus on end user satisfaction, application enablement and unifying the management of endpoints,” said Stacy Crook, research director, IDC’s Enterprise Mobility research practice.

AirWatch by VMware is the largest EMM provider with $200 million in bookings and 15,000 customers in 2014.
